"Joint statement by researchers calling for the suspension of appeal against state compensation lawsuit over death of Ghanaian national repatriated to Japan" has been issued.

Professor Ichiro Watanabe and Professor Emeritus Hiroshi Komai presenting the joint statement

Following the Tokyo District Court's ruling on the "Suraj Case Lawsuit for State Compensation" on Wednesday, March 19, 75 researchers involved in research on issues and policies regarding foreigners and immigrants issued a "Joint Statement by Researchers Calling for No Appeal in the Lawsuit for State Compensation in the Case of the Death of a Ghanaian National Repatriated at State Expenses."

On behalf of the 75 researchers, Professor Ichiro Watanabe of Meisei University and Professor Emeritus Hiroshi Komai of the University of Tsukuba
The joint statement was delivered to the Minister of Justice. Ms. Yuki Kawai, Deputy Director-General of the Immigration Bureau of the Ministry of Justice, received the statement.
